OneDrive
Microsoft OneDrive is Microsoft’s cloud-storage and file-sync service baked into Windows and Microsoft 365 for backing up, sharing, and collaborating on files from any device.
Military use
OneDrive for Business is certified for use in Microsoft’s Government Cloud, the same enclave the U.S. Department of Defense relies on for classified workloads. Through the department-wide “DoD 365” rollout, OneDrive has become the default cloud-storage and file-sync tool across military branches; even the Coast Guard has migrated its file shares.
